The most common injection method is where a microsyringe is used to inject sample through a rubber septum into a flash port at the top of the column. The temperature of the sample port is usually about 50C higher than the boiling point of the least volatile component of the sample.
With on-column injection a liquid sample is introduced directly into the column with a thin injection needle. During the course of the temperature program the vapour pressure of the solutes increases and the chromatographic process begins. With this injection technique no evaporation in a heated space takes place.
Headspace sampling: In this technique, the liquid or solid sample is added to a glass vial until it establishes equilibrium. Some of the analytes vaporize from the liquid or solid and enter the headspace above the sample.
The injection is an important step in chromatography. As its name suggests, the aim is to inject the sample to be analyzed into the HPLC system. Generally speaking, two injection systems will be available, either a manual injection, or an automatic one.
A micro syringe injects sample through a rubber septum into a Flash vaporiser. The temperature of the sample port is usually about 50C higher than the boiling point of the lowest boiling component of the sample mixture. The injection volumes generally range between 0.5 to 5l.
